QUOTE(TitanRev @ Mar 11 2015, 05:24 PM) » Click to show Spoiler - click again to hide... «  Pardon my kindergarten like drawing because I use finger to try on my screen. 1. the 2 outlet from rocker cover I use a T joint and a brass reducer to make this. The right side rocker cover breather hole is bigger than the 1 on left so you will need to different sizes of hose then you will know how to joint them up with the T joint and the reducer. Then I pull a single hose from the 2 joined ones into the OCT and the OCT outlet I just let it vent into atmosphere. 2. How about the hole at the intake pipe and at the intake manifold? I just plug them off with an silicone end cap where you can find in performance shops or spare part shop. cheap stuff only. Wahla you are done. 1 more thing, make sure you mount your OCT away from the hot engine as far as possible or a place away from heat where the oil an cold down and pleace the OCT lower than your rocker cover so the condensed oil will flow into the tank..my when clean has a lot of oil inside For your OCT you can use tupperware to make also. drill 2 holes into the side and put 2 male nipper into the tupperware and connect with hose. good tupperware..that can stand oven mia  how big for the silicon end cap?

A note though Walbro got 2 types of in tank fuel pump although most the reference is not clear. Our stock FP body diameter is 37mm IINM the Walbro are 38mm and it will not fit, you need to find the Walbro pump with body diameter which is smaller and the internal design is different. It looks similar to the GS series but body just different diameter. I got the wrong pump and had to replaced them to the right one. Also our stock harness will be enough to power the Walbro given that your supply is above 12V. With AC and load I'm getting 13. 87V and when rad fan kick in the V dips to 12.50V and back up again. I've already wired my relay kit to power the pump but not utilized it yet because the stock FPR will not able to regulate the fuel pressure if I increase the FP duty cycle. So I will need to run new fuel lines and ditch the returnless system to a return type before I up the supply to 14.60V to the FP and change out the stock wiring to the pump.
